Locate the Battery

The battery in a BMW X5 is typically located in the trunk, under the floor panel. Follow these steps to access the battery:

  1. Open the trunk of your BMW X5.
  2. Remove the floor panel by lifting it up.
  3. Locate the battery compartment.

Prepare for Battery Removal

Before removing the old battery, take the necessary precautions to prevent any accidents or damage:

  1. Put on protective gloves and eyewear to ensure your safety.
  2. Ensure that the ignition is turned off and the key is removed from the vehicle.
  3. Make sure all electrical systems in the car are turned off, including lights, radio, and air conditioning.

Disconnect the Old Battery

Follow these steps to disconnect the old battery from your BMW X5:

  1. Identify the positive and negative terminals on the battery. The positive terminal is usually marked with a plus sign (+), while the negative terminal is marked with a minus sign (-).
  2. Using a socket wrench, loosen the nut on the negative terminal and carefully remove the negative cable from the battery.
  3. Repeat the same process for the positive terminal, loosening the nut and removing the positive cable from the battery.
  4. Inspect the battery cables for any signs of corrosion or damage. If necessary, clean the terminals using a battery terminal cleaner and a terminal brush.

Remove the Old Battery

Once the battery is disconnected, it’s time to remove the old battery from your BMW X5:

  1. Remove any mounting brackets or clamps holding the battery in place.
  2. Lift the old battery out of the compartment carefully, ensuring that you have a firm grip.
  3. Place the old battery aside in a safe and secure location.

Prepare the New Battery

Before installing the new battery, it’s important to prepare it properly:

  1. Inspect the new battery for any signs of damage.
  2. If the terminals on the new battery are covered with plastic caps, remove them.
  3. Clean the terminals on the new battery using a battery terminal cleaner and a terminal brush.

Install the New Battery

Follow these steps to install the new battery in your BMW X5:

  1. Place the new battery into the battery compartment, ensuring that it is positioned correctly.
  2. Secure the battery in place by reinstalling any mounting brackets or clamps that were removed earlier.
  3. Attach the positive cable to the positive terminal of the new battery, tightening the nut securely.
  4. Repeat the same process for the negative cable, attaching it to the negative terminal and tightening the nut.

Test the New Battery

After installing the new battery, it’s important to test it to ensure everything is functioning properly:

  1. Turn on the ignition and check if all electrical systems are working correctly.
  2. Start the engine and let it run for a few minutes to ensure the battery is charging properly.
  3. If you encounter any issues, double-check the battery connections and consult a professional if necessary.

Properly Dispose of the Old Battery

It’s essential to dispose of the old battery safely and responsibly. Car batteries contain harmful chemicals, so you must follow the correct disposal procedures:

  1. Contact your local recycling center or auto parts store to inquire about battery recycling programs.
  2. Follow their guidelines for proper disposal, ensuring that the battery is recycled in an environmentally friendly manner.

Maintaining Your New Battery

To maximize the lifespan and performance of your new battery, consider the following maintenance tips:

  • Regularly clean the battery terminals and cables to prevent corrosion.
  • Check the battery’s fluid levels regularly and top up if necessary, following the manufacturer’s instructions.
  • Ensure that the battery is securely fastened in place to prevent vibrations that could damage the connections.
  • Protect the battery from extreme temperatures, as excessive heat or cold can affect its performance.

Do I need to register or code the new car battery in a BMW X5?

In some cases, it may be necessary to register or code the new car battery in a BMW X5. It is recommended to consult the owner’s manual or seek assistance from a certified BMW technician to ensure proper battery registration.
